Dyne Therapeutics, Inc. (Nasdaq: DYN), a clinical-stage muscle disease company focused on advancing innovative life-transforming therapeutics for people living with genetically driven diseases, today announced that the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has granted orphan drug designation for DYNE-101 for the treatment of myotonic dystrophy type 1 (DM1). DYNE-101 is being evaluated in the Phase 1/2 global ACHIEVE clinical trial with initial data on safety, tolerability and splicing from the multiple ascending dose, placebo-controlled portion of the trial anticipated in the second half of 2023.
